Output 41c3e671278f4c80267a34613d9953531ccacc87c948180020715e9c7f454d4e:0

value
100654081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fe2483527037a028596233b86302a56b668be6 OP_EQUAL
address
37tXeY2icY4EZYTfaBjp9oZ7cEjnHqLGUh
transaction
41c3e671278f4c80267a34613d9953531ccacc87c948180020715e9c7f454d4e
spent
true